The Pop Ups will debut their new musical, Radio Jungle in Brooklyn on April 22nd. The performance also celebrates the release of their second CD release, a ready-for-primetime collection.

The Pop Ups have won national critical acclaim for their stage show “PASTA: A Pop Ups Puppet Musical,” which has enjoyed successful runs in New York and Los Angeles, as well as the fall 2011 Yo Gabba Gabba Live Tour, press notes state. PASTA! is an educational and comic musical adventure through the magical land of Brooklyn. With the audience’s help, The Pop Ups search for the ingredients to make the best (locally sourced) pasta sauce ever. The kid and adult-friendly show features colorful puppetry (created by puppeteers from The Muppet Show, Forgetting Sarah Marshall and Dinosaur Rock). The Pop Ups plan a performance of PASTA! A Pop Ups Puppet Musical on Saturday, March 31st, as part of Symphony Space's weekly Just Kidding performance series.

With Radio Jungle, their new comedic, musical adventure, The Pop Ups find more than they bargained for when a normal trip to Pop Up City turns into a fantastic quest through the jungles of Mexico. New puppet friends join the crew from the PASTA! show to help The Pop Ups find every color of the rainbow in a high energy, ecological scavenger hunt.

Copies of The Pop Ups’ new CD Radio Jungle (April 3) will be available for purchase at the show.
